Portland is Oregon's largest city, with a population exceeding 650,000 and a metro area of over 2.5 million. The city's construction market is one of the most active and competitive on the West Coast, driven by continued population growth, commercial development, and a multi-family housing sector that has been building steadily for over a decade. Portland's construction landscape spans everything from the dense urban core downtown and in the Pearl District to the established residential neighborhoods of Southeast Portland, the suburban growth areas of East Portland, and the commercial corridors along Barbur Boulevard, Powell Boulevard, and 82nd Avenue. Each area presents different construction contexts, from seismic retrofit requirements in unreinforced masonry buildings downtown to residential ADU construction in the inner neighborhoods to ground-up commercial development in the expanding eastern districts.

Navigating Portland's Stringent Building Requirements

Portland's Bureau of Development Services (BDS) administers one of the most rigorous building code enforcement programs in Oregon. The city operates under Multnomah County jurisdiction with additional Portland-specific overlay requirements covering everything from energy efficiency to tree preservation to design review in certain neighborhoods. Commercial projects in design overlay zones may require a Type II or Type III land use review before building permits can be issued, adding weeks or months to the project timeline.

Portland has been a national leader in green building requirements. The city's commercial energy code exceeds Oregon's statewide minimum, and residential projects are increasingly expected to incorporate energy-efficient systems, low-VOC materials, and stormwater management features. For multi-family projects, Portland's inclusionary housing requirements may apply, mandating a percentage of affordable units in developments above a certain size. We factor all of these requirements into our project planning and bidding so clients are not surprised by costs or timelines that emerge during permitting.
